Twitter Mischief Hijacks Reputations
Posted by: Walaika Haskins January 6, 2009 03:29 PMThe revelation Monday that 33 accounts on the Twitter social networking site had been hacked, while others were compromised by a phishing scam over the weekend, highlights what cyber criminals can do. Accounts belonging to Britney Spears, Barack Obama and CNN’s Rick Sanchez were hacked, using tools normally accessible only to Twitter’s technical support team for the purpose of letting locked-out subscribers reset their e-mail addresses.
